#553396 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#553396 is composed of 33.3% red, 20%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.3% cyan, 66%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 260.6 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 39.4%. #553396 color hex could be obtained by blending #aa66ff with #00002d.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#553396 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#553396 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#553396 has RGB values of R:85, G:51,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 5583766.
